Tapering of Biologics in Chronic Rhinosinusitis With Nasal Polyps

About this trial

The purpose of this study is to investigate the feasibility of extending the dosing intervals of biological therapies while maintaining optimal treatment effects in chronic rhinosinusitis with nasal polyps (CRSwNP).

Eligibility criteria

Qualifiers

≥18 years of age.

Currently receiving treatment with either dupilumab (300 mg) or mepolizumab (100 mg) every four weeks.

Having received the biologic at unchanged dosing interval for at least three months.
